K12教育赛事综合服务平台
聚乐之家官方网站
下载聚乐之家官方App
专注青少年竞赛题库网站
以下选项围绕哈夫曼编码的实现逻辑展开,请选出描述正确的一项。
构建哈夫曼树时,需使用大顶堆来获取当前权值最小的两个节点进行合并
哈夫曼编码属于前缀编码,任意一个字符的编码都不能是其他字符编码的前缀,可避免解码歧义
对包含n个不同字符的集合构建哈夫曼树时,最终生成的哈夫曼树总共有2n个节点
哈夫曼编码的解码过程可以脱离哈夫曼树,仅通过编码的长度即可完成字符拆分解码